Hiring a plumber is one of those tasks that feels simple until the issue is currently on the flooring. A leaking shutoff valve can become a soaked cabinet in an hour. A slow sewer backup can become a weekend emergency. When people type "Plumber Near me" into a search bar, they generally want speed, but speed alone is a bad method to choose somebody who will be opening walls, handling gas lines, working on drains, or solving a problem that can cost even more if it is rated instead of detected correctly.
In Philadelphia, credentials matter for another factor. The city has a wide variety of housing stock, from 19th-century rowhomes with older piping to refurbished apartments with newer mechanical systems. A plumber who understands that mix needs more than a truck and a wrench. They need the ideal licensing, insurance coverage, training, and local experience to work securely and legally. If you are comparing a Plumber Philadelphia search engine result versus a few Plumbing Services Philadelphia companies, the credentials behind the logo design inform you a lot about what type of work you are most likely to get.
The first credential to verify is the Philadelphia pipes license
If a plumber is going to deal with plumbing systems in Philadelphia, they must be properly licensed for the work they perform. That sounds apparent, but it is where numerous property owners get tripped up. A company can have a nice site, a local phone number, and plenty of evaluations, yet still send out a worker who is not licensed for the job at hand.
A legitimate license matters due to the fact that it shows the plumber has actually satisfied the city or state requirements to perform plumbing work legally. It likewise informs you that the person has actually been vetted to some degree on code understanding and practical ability. Plumbing in Philadelphia is not just about joining pipes. It can include venting requirements, backflow concerns, component clearances, drain sizing, gas line security, and permits for specific kinds of work. A licensed plumber is anticipated to understand when a repair is simple and when it crosses into work that needs inspection or authorization.
If you are hiring for a simple faucet swap, you may not believe licensing matters much. It still does. The wrong setup can trigger leakages behind a vanity, damage a shutoff valve, or develop an issue that will appear later. For larger work, like sewer repair, water heater replacement, or rerouting lines, the license is not optional in any practical sense. It is the beginning point.
Insurance is not a benefit, it is protection
A certified plumber needs to carry insurance, specifically basic liability coverage, and oftentimes employees' settlement too. This is one of those information house owners often skip since it feels administrative, till a tool drops into a tile flooring or a fitting fails and floods a basement.
Insurance separates a professional operation from somebody doing side work with no safety net. If a plumber punctures a pipe, damages flooring, or causes another loss while working, insurance coverage is what assists cover the cost. Employees' settlement matters too, since it secures you if somebody gets hurt while working on your property. Without it, the legal and monetary fallout can get messy fast.
When I talk with homeowners about working with a Plumber Near me, I typically suggest asking directly whether the company is guaranteed and whether they can supply proof. A great business will not act upset. They will be used to the concern, because property owners who have actually been burned before tend to ask it early.
Training and apprenticeship are worth more than a flashy ad
The best plumbers do not come out of no place. Most have actually invested years discovering under knowledgeable tradespeople before they ever worked separately. That apprenticeship matters because plumbing is a trade where the details conceal behind walls, under slabs, and inside old systems that do not constantly behave according to textbook logic.
Formal training is valuable, but so is field experience. A plumber who has actually worked through Philadelphia winter seasons knows how frozen lines behave in older rowhomes. Someone who has invested years opening cast iron stacks and working around aging supply lines understands the difference in between a short-term fix and a repair that will actually hold. When a business markets Emergency Plumbing Services Philadelphia, that experience is especially important. Emergency situations do not offer you time for experimentation. The plumber needs to arrive, check out the symptoms quickly, and make good choices under pressure.
This is where qualifications end up being more than documents. Training tells you the plumber has actually learned the trade. Experience tells you whether they can apply it in a home that was developed before modern pipes requirements, or in a 3 a.m. Leakage where the water shutoff is rusted and half-hidden behind a finished wall.
Philadelphia code knowledge is a real credential, even if it is not framed that way
A plumber can be licensed and still be a poor fit if they do not understand regional code expectations. Philadelphia homes frequently present a mix of older building and construction methods and later updates. That indicates a repair may look basic on the surface area but have code implications underneath.
For example, venting problems can be overlooked by less knowledgeable plumbing professionals who focus just on the noticeable leak. Water heater replacement can get complicated if the venting, clearances, or drain pan setup are not remedy. Sewer and drain work may need attention to slope, cleanouts, and the way existing lines were tied in decades ago. A plumber who is utilized to modern tract homes elsewhere might not immediately appreciate the peculiarities of a South Philly rowhome or a transformed duplex in a structure that has actually been remodeled numerous times.
When a plumber has deep local understanding, they are less likely to guess. They know when a system is worn out but functional, when a quick repair might create future difficulty, and when an upgrade deserves suggesting before the next failure.
The right credentials for emergency work are a little different
Not every plumber who can manage routine maintenance is geared up for emergency calls. When the line breaks at night or the basement starts handling water, you require somebody with both technical capability and the discipline to work fast without making the problem worse.
For Emergency Plumber Philadelphia work, search for a company that can do more than respond to the phone. They should have specialists trained to separate systems, stop active leakages, and support the circumstance. They need to also understand how to explain the next steps plainly, because emergency tasks often involve a momentary repair first and a long-term repair later.
A strong emergency credential set typically consists of correct licensing, insurance coverage, and on-call experience. Simply as important, the company must have a track record of managing immediate calls without turning every problem into a sales pitch. If a plumber arrives and immediately starts discussing a complete repipe before they have identified the source of the leakage, that is not a great indication. Emergency work need to start with containment, not alarm.
Permits, evaluations, and the capability to work easily with them
Some plumbing operate in Philadelphia needs authorizations or evaluations. A competent plumber needs to understand when that applies and should not leave the property owner to arrange it out alone. If a business is incredibly elusive about permits, that is a warning sign.
This matters more than individuals believe. A homeowner may save a little upfront by working with someone who skips the proper process, then pay for it later on when the work is flagged throughout a sale, insurance coverage claim, or restoration. Licenses are not simply paperwork. They assist validate that work was done to basic and recorded properly.
An excellent plumber explains this plainly. They do not conceal behind lingo or reject the subject. They understand which tasks are uncomplicated service calls and which ones require city involvement. That sort of clearness is a credential in itself, since it shows the plumber is used to doing the job correctly, not simply quickly.
Ask how they identify, not just how they repair
One of the most revealing features of a plumber is how they speak about diagnosis. An experienced professional does not leap straight to a theory before asking concerns or examining the system. They think of pressure, age of the piping, component history, drain design, and whether the problem is isolated or part of a larger pattern.
This is particularly crucial in older Philadelphia homes. A repeating drain blockage might be brought on by a bad habit in https://zionfkbr419.theglensecret.com/emergency-plumber-in-philadelphia-how-to-examine-pros-and-what-services-to-anticipate-24-7 the line, tree roots, a stubborn belly in the pipe, or decades of buildup in a section of cast iron. A faucet that seems to "simply leakage" might in fact be the symptom of pressure variations or a stopping working valve body. If the plumber can not explain the thinking behind their conclusion, you are taking a gamble.
Good medical diagnosis is not simply wise, it saves cash. It prevents unnecessary replacement and keeps the job focused. A plumber who knows how to separate the real source of an issue typically fixes it when instead of returning three months later on for the same issue.
A brief checklist can help you evaluate a plumber fast
When you are comparing a couple of choices for Plumbing Services Philadelphia, these 5 checks normally tell you a lot before the appointment is even booked.
- Ask for licensing info and confirm the plumber is qualified for the work.
- Verify insurance protection, including liability and employees' compensation.
- Ask whether they have experience with the kind of property you own, especially if it is older or has been renovated.
- Find out how they handle licenses and assessments when the job needs them.
- Ask for a clear explanation of how they diagnose the issue before they change parts.
That is not about being challenging. It is about not inviting preventable issues into your home.
Reviews matter, but read them like a tradesperson would
Online reviews can assist, however they need to not be the only filter. A hundred radiant remarks can still conceal a business that is fantastic at marketing and mediocre at complicated repairs. The useful evaluations are the ones that describe what the plumber actually did, how they interacted, whether they showed up on time, and how the issue held up afterward.
Look for patterns. If people repeatedly discuss clear explanations, tidy work, and reasonable quotes, that normally implies something. If grievances cluster around missed out on consultations, unclear pricing, or brief repairs, that should have attention. Evaluations are most useful when they validate what the qualifications already suggest.
The strongest Plumber Philadelphia services generally have both: solid certifications and a service style that leaves individuals confident enough to recommend them.
There is a difference in between a handyman and a plumber
This is an easy error for property owners to make, specifically when the job looks small. A loose trap, a running toilet, or a leaking supply line can appear simple enough for "somebody handy." But plumbing work has a way of expanding. What begins as a small leak can end up being a harmed subfloor, mold, or a shutoff that stops working the first time it is touched.
A handyman may work for trim, paint, light fixtures, or general household maintenance. A plumber brings particular training for water system, drainage, venting, and sometimes gas work. That difference matters when the work involves pressure, hidden piping, or anything that could damage the structure of the home.
If you are searching for a Plumber Near me because the problem is immediate, the temptation is to employ whoever can show up fastest. That can work for basic jobs, however if the task is more than surface-level, the credential space becomes costly really quickly.
What the very best plumbing technicians tend to describe before they start
The most reliable plumbing professionals I have seen share a few habits in common. They explain the concern in plain language. They tell you what is immediate and what can wait. They are sincere when a repair is a spot and not an irreversible fix. They likewise respect the truth that house owners want to comprehend the expense before the work begins.
That level of communication is not additional. It belongs to being credentialed in a real-world sense. A knowledgeable technician who can not describe the problem might still know the trade, but they will be tough to trust in a demanding scenario. Good interaction is often the difference in between a service call that feels controlled and one that feels like a sales event.
This is specifically true when the issue remains in a concealed area. An excellent plumber will inform you what they can see, what they think, and what they still need to check. They should not assure certainty where there is none. Pipes is a hands-on trade, and the truthful response is sometimes, "We will understand more once we open this section and inspect it."
